1. In the first example, there really is no DKIM signature on emails. Look at the cases in which you can leave a letter without a signature, at least it happens on reports about the impossibility of delivery, but there the scope in spf will not be mailfrom but helo. This may be some kind of mail generated on the server itself and passed by the usual delivery mechanisms on which you impose a DKIM signature (for example, if you impose a DKIM on letters from authorized SMTP users, and this letter is generated locally).
2. The second case is a redirect, it passes DKIM authorization, so it will pass DMARC and will be accepted even with a strict policy. For DMARC, it is sufficient that the address from From be authorized by any of the SPF or DKIM mechanisms.
3. The third case is most likely spam from a fake address.
